SPECIFICATIONS

Parameters
Width 3.9mm
Thickness 1.5mm
RoHS Status RoHS Compliant
Lead Free Lead Free
Factory Lead Time 7 Weeks
Mount Surface Mount
Package / Case SOIC
Number of Pins 8
Published 1999
JESD-609 Code e3
Pbfree Code yes
Part Status Active
Moisture Sensitivity Level (MSL) 1
Number of Terminations 8
ECCN Code EAR99
Terminal Finish Matte Tin (Sn) - annealed
Max Operating Temperature 85°C
Min Operating Temperature -40°C
Technology CMOS
Terminal Position DUAL
Terminal Form GULL WING
Peak Reflow Temperature (Cel) NOT SPECIFIED
Supply Voltage 3.3V
Time@Peak Reflow Temperature-Max (s) NOT SPECIFIED
Pin Count 8
Number of Outputs 2
Qualification Status Not Qualified
Power Supplies 3.3/5V
Temperature Grade INDUSTRIAL
Number of Circuits 1
Max Supply Voltage 5.5V
Min Supply Voltage 3.13V
Nominal Supply Current 25mA
Max Supply Current 25mA
Frequency (Max) 27MHz
Input Clock
Primary Clock/Crystal Frequency-Nom 27MHz
Height 1.5mm
Length 4.9mm
